Autocomplete feature was introduced by Microsoft in their web browser Internet Explorer (IE) since IE version 5. In the earlier version, it was limited to the auto completion of web addresses that you type in the browser's address bar. The later versions of IE included autocomplete support for various things like email addresses and passwords.
If enabled, autocomplete lists possible matches for the entries you have typed before in web forms etc. It can be enabled or disabled from Tools » Internet options » Content » AutoComplete. You can enable (turn ON) or disable (turn OFF) autocomplete for web addresses, forms and user names & passwords on forms.
You can also delete previous autocomplete entries/values of these things. To delete an individual entry, select it from the drop-down list for that field, and press delete.
